Step-by-step explanation:

Given

x² + 3x - 4 = 6 ( subtract 6 from both sides )

x² + 3x - 10 = 0 ← in standard form

Consider the factors of the constant term (- 10) which sum to give the coefficient of the x- term (+ 3)

The factors are + 5 and - 2, since

5 × - 2 = - 10 and 5 - 2 = + 3, thus

(x + 5)(x - 2) = 0 ← in factored form

Equate each factor to zero and solve for x

x + 5 = 0 ⇒ x = - 5

x - 2 = 0 ⇒ x = 2

solution set is { - 5, 2 } → A

<h3>Definition of map and scale</h3>

A map is a representation of a place, at a size smaller than the real size.

The scale of a cartographic representation is the relationship of similarity between the real dimensions of the geographical space represented and those of its image on the map. That is, the scale is defined as the proportionality relationship that exists between a distance measured on the ground and its corresponding measurement on the map.

One way to represent the scale is by a fraction, which indicates the proportion between the distance on a map and its corresponding distance in reality:

Scale=\frac{distance on the map}{distance in reality}
